Sons of agricultural workers read the camp newspaper at the Agua Fria migratory labor camp in Maricopa County, Arizona. In May 1940, this image reflects the daily life of migrant families affected by the Great Depression. The camp provided essential resources and community for those who worked in agriculture during this challenging time.
